Learn More Fighting the Border Wall Rachel’s Network joined the Texas Civil Rights Project, the Center for Biological Diversity, and the Sierra Club to draw the public’s attention to the landscapes and communities threatened by border walls, strengthen the coalition fighting these projects, and resist further construction in the courts. Learn More Latest News Rachel’s Network Provides Grant to Student PIRGs’ New Voter Project Oct 13, 2020 Young people continue to be underrepresented in our democracy, and COVID-19 has severely curtailed traditional youth voter registration efforts. As a result, Student PIRGs’ New Voters Project is using digital tools to reach potential voters and providing the information they need to navigate the 2020 election and beyond. Rachel’s Network is providing Student PIRGs a grant to help enable this work. Rachel’s Network Joins Amicus Brief Demanding Equal Rights Amendment be Enshrined in Constitution Jun 30, 2020 In January 2020, Virginia became the 38th state to ratify the Equal Rights Amendment (ERA), but the federal government refuses to enshrine it in the US Constitution. Rachel’s Network, along with founder Winsome McIntosh’s McIntosh Foundation, have filed a legal brief supporting three states in their lawsuit against the federal government for failing to uphold the ERA. 2019 Annual Report Jun 25, 2020 For 20 years, the women in our network have used their voices and resources to uplift other women and contribute to solutions. BECOME A MEMBER Join Now Our Mission Rachel’s Network is a community of women at the intersection of environmental advocacy, philanthropy, and leadership. Our mission is to promote women as impassioned leaders and agents of change dedicated to the stewardship of the earth.
